Matayula is a Rural village located in Didihat, Pithoragarh, Uttarakhand.
The total population of Matayula is 45.
Matayula village comprises 11 households.
The literacy rate in Matayula is 73.8%. Among the literate population of 31, there are 15 literate males and 16 literate females.
In Matayula, there are 21 males and 24 females, with a sex ratio of 1143 females per 1000 males.
There are 3 children (6.7% of population), comprising 3 boys and 0 girls.
The total number of workers in Matayula is 26, with 8 main workers and 18 marginal workers.
Social category data is not available for Matayula.
Matayula is located in Uttarakhand state, Pithoragarh district, and falls under Didihat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 49447 and LGD code is 49447.
